[figure: see text] A solid-phase route to substituted benzimidazoles has been developed using a modified base-labile linker strategy to release the final products in a traceless manner. This approach permits the synthesis of diverse compounds in moderate yields and high purity.
An on-line sample preparation method utilizing a time-programmed autosampler is described for high throughput liquid chromatography/mass spectrometry (LC/MS). This approach is particularly helpful for the LC/MS analysis of samples which require solvents incompatible with HPLC in the sample preparation process. The on-line sample preparation approach minimizes a bottleneck in throughput and improves sample recovery under some circumstances.
